A Man Called Ove by Fredrik Backman




Title:  A Man Called Ove
Author:  Fredrik Backman
Publisher:  Atria Books
Sold By:  Simon and Schuster Digital Sales, Inc.
Language:  English
ASIN:  B00GEEB730
Source:  Purchased from Amazon

This was the first book I read by Fredrik Buckman and I love it so much that I am now on a mission to read all of his books.  The protagonist, Ove is not your average, well loved book character.  He is an angry, short tempered, senior citizen that has definitely not moved into the 21st century.  He has basically been a loner since his wife died, and her passing did nothing to improve his disposition.  He follows rigid rules and expects everyone else to also follow them.  However, one day a young couple moves in to the house next door and shakes Ove's world up.  The wife is very talkative and very pregnant and on their first meeting she manages to plow down Ove's mail box.

The young woman always seems to somehow overlook Ove's cantankerous  moods and talk.  Despite Ove's repeated attempts to avoid these people, the woman manages to befriend him,  Well, sort of befriend him.  This story is centered around this odd friendship.  There is plenty of things both of these people will learn about themselves, as well as each other. It is a story of heartbreak, humor, and sorrow, but mostly it is a beautiful story of love kindness and friendship.  Ove might not seem to be an interesting character at first glance, but if you give him a chance, he will steal your heart.
